As a long time stutterer, I asked this question myself, but then realised that I don't really need to distance myself from the stutter. I stutter the most when I tell my own name. My own identity. But that didn't put me down. I started working on things that made me happy. Embrace your stutter and only look forward to things in life that make you happy.
